Transaction 6f62f4594d165819ee3e6444b3887c2b7707627b7e59d4d07b8b2bfde851dfc4
1 Input
1 Output
-
6f62f4594d165819ee3e6444b3887c2b7707627b7e59d4d07b8b2bfde851dfc4:0
- value
- 21868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ef69dcf3211a7e6eccf76d43765eb5950974c55b OP_EQUAL
- address
- 3PWvEtRAc17R95UcJMzAMg56BJdeXEwURD